Students Fly Space Shuttle with an Atari VCS
Article Abstract:
Grade school students have flown a simulation of the NASA space-shuttle from liftoff, to orbit, to satellite rendezvous, reentry, and California landing on an Atari 2600 Video Computer System. The shuttle mission was designed by Steve Kitchen of Activision Inc. after research at NASA. A screen display shows the layout of the simulator. The project was designed to educate students about the space program.

Who Owns What? Earth Law for Space
Article Abstract:
New laws controlling man's activities in space are needed but are difficult to create. Sovereignty, national security, and who should make the laws are problems confronted in the making of space laws. Laws of sovereignty on earth can not be applied directly to outer space.

Space Tomorrow: The Antarctica Model
Article Abstract:
Space activity in the year 2008 will be cooperative efforts of many nations. Like the exploration of Antarctica, international bases will be set up on the moon, Mars, or asteroids. The Space Shuttle and an earth-orbiting base are keys to this exploration.
